原文:QT 界面全分辨率適配

通常我們在QT適配不同窗口大小的時候,是通過布局的方式來解決的。 但是如果窗口中的控件很多,而且有的控件需要疊放在別的控件上方,各個控件之間的位置沒有什么規律而言的情況下,想要使用布局來適配各種分辨率,就極其困難,就算做出來,那工作量特別特別特別大 而且在后期想要對界面進行修改的時候,也是極其不方便的。 在一片博客中提到了這樣的方法,可以解決這樣的問題:https: www.cnblogs.com ...

2021-07-16 13:43 0 404 推薦指數:

查看詳情

3.QT屏幕分辨率適配

需求:qt的窗口、組件、字體需要適配屏幕分辨率。 思路:qt是根據顯示器的物理長度或者寬度於分辨率的關系來計算dpi 實現: 注意:需要寫在main()里 ...

Wed Jun 09 05:31:00 CST 2021 0 211
Qt 使用全局縮放進行分辨率適配QT_SCALE_FACTOR)

事出有因  因為現在做的一個項目是全程全屏顯示的。因此不同屏幕分辨率對程序界面的影響太大。而UI設計的時候又沒有過多的考慮自動布局這方面的事。  雖然在剛開始做界面的時候已經盡量利用自動布局來做,但是有些控件提供的圖片大小不太合適,在做的時候只能給控件設置固定大小。在測試不同分辨率的時候發現界面 ...

Fri May 28 18:19:00 CST 2021 0 3224
適配不同分辨率

在drawable中的圖片在不同密度的設備上顯示時,在屏幕上的占比是不一樣的。 如:160px的圖片,在800x480的屏幕上顯示: 密度是: 160dpi時,占屏幕的三分之一 (=160px/48 ...

Sun Jul 28 05:40:00 CST 2013 0 3165
Android 分辨率適配

一、屏幕尺寸   屏幕尺寸是指對角線長度,1英寸等於2.54厘米。   Android設備中常見尺寸有:2.8、3.5、3.7、4.2、5.0、5.5、6.0等。 二、屏幕分辨率   屏幕分辨率是指縱橫向的像素點,1px=1像素,px是pixel。分辨率表示是縱向x橫向 ...

Wed Nov 10 05:53:00 CST 2021 0 135
QT界面自適應屏幕分辨率

背景:在不同電腦上運行同一個VS編譯的軟件時,有的電腦上界面顯示不全。 解決方法: 1.先用QGroupBox把各個對象分門別類放好; 2.利用Layouts和布局,把ui界面擺好。 3.想要自適應調整的對象,就把這個對象的水平策略和垂直策略設置為Ignored。 ...

Fri Jan 29 02:22:00 CST 2021 0 1298
(11)UI布局和分辨率適配

一、Cocos編輯器 自動布局系統主要涉及固定與拉伸屬性:   如圖,總共可以修改控件的上下左右四個圖釘和中間的兩個拉伸條六個屬性。 效果   1.當打開其中的任意一個圖釘時,當前節點與父 ...

Thu Feb 04 01:33:00 CST 2016 0 3685
iOS多設備分辨率適配

6,iOS平台尺寸適配問題終於還是來了,移動設計全面進入“雜屏”時代。看看下面三款iPhone尺寸和分辨 ...

Thu Apr 14 01:14:00 CST 2016 0 1790
android 分辨率適配的方法

首先說明一點:這個方法不能說萬能的,但是最起碼它解決了分辨率跟密集度的關系,就是所有分辨率,只要傳了第一次的參數,后面都不需要改動了,但是也引來一個問題,就是布局會因為圖片資源小而失真,所以這也需要美工的同志多多配合的,廢話不說,貼代碼: 第一步,先創建一個view信息的javabean類 ...

Mon Oct 22 23:09:00 CST 2012 4 7976
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M